AI Agent

An AI system that can take actions on its own once given a goal, sometimes across multiple tools.

Why it matters: Agents don’t just suggest — they do. That changes risk and accountability.


AI Copilot

An AI assistant embedded into everyday software (email, documents, CRM) to help draft, summarise, analyse, or suggest.

Why it matters: Productivity increases — so does the amount of data passing through AI.


AI Fatigue

When staff tune out because every product, update, and feature is now labelled “AI-powered”.

Why it matters: The novelty has gone. Only real value cuts through.


AI Governance

The rules around who can use AI, for what purpose, with which data, and who is accountable.

Why it matters: Boards, insurers, and regulators are now asking about this explicitly.


AI Orchestration

Co-ordinating multiple AI tools, agents, and automations so they work together sensibly.

Why it matters: Most businesses no longer use just one AI tool.


AI Readiness

How prepared a business’s data, processes, and controls are for AI to work properly.

Why it matters: Turning AI on without preparation usually disappoints.


AI App Builder

Platforms that use AI to generate apps, tools, or code from plain-English instructions.

Why it matters: Software creation has become fast, cheap, and widely accessible.


Agentic AI

AI designed to make decisions and act independently, rather than waiting for prompts.

Why it matters: 2025 is when AI shifted from “helping” to “acting”.


API (Application Programming Interface)

A mechanism that allows different software systems to talk to each other.

Why it matters: APIs are what power automation and data sharing.


Automation

Using rules and integrations to remove repetitive manual work.

Why it matters: Good automation saves time. Bad automation breaks quietly.


Citizen Developer

A non-technical employee who builds tools or automations to solve business problems.

Why it matters: Most SMBs already have them — whether they know it or not.


Data Governance

Deciding who can access data, where it can go, and how it can be used.

Why it matters: Most AI risk is actually data risk.


Data Hygiene

How clean, structured, and reliable your data is.

Why it matters: AI amplifies mess faster than traditional software ever did.


Data Residency

The physical location where data is stored.

Why it matters: Different locations mean different legal and compliance obligations.


Explainable AI (XAI)

AI systems where you can understand why a decision or output was produced.

Why it matters: Trust, regulation, and insurance increasingly depend on explanation.


Hallucination (AI)

When an AI confidently produces incorrect or made-up information.

Why it matters: AI doesn’t know when it’s wrong.


Human-in-the-Loop (HITL)

A setup where a human reviews or approves AI output before it becomes action.

Why it matters: Prevents automated mistakes becoming real-world problems.


Low-Code

Platforms that reduce the amount of traditional coding required, but still need technical thinking.

Why it matters: Speeds up development without removing IT oversight.


Model Drift

When an AI’s accuracy degrades over time because real-world data changes.

Why it matters: Continuous AI use needs ongoing monitoring.


No-Code

Visual, drag-and-drop tools that let non-technical users build apps and workflows.

Why it matters: Powerful for productivity, risky without visibility.


Platform Lock-In

Being so tied into one software provider that switching becomes difficult or expensive.

Why it matters: AI features are now deeply embedded, not optional add-ons.


Prompt Engineering

Writing clear, structured instructions to get reliable results from AI tools.

Why it matters: Better prompts = better outputs.


Retrieval-Augmented Generation (RAG)

Allowing AI to reference approved information sources before answering.

Why it matters: Reduces hallucinations and improves accuracy with business data.


SaaS (Software as a Service)

Subscription-based software accessed via the internet, managed by the vendor.

Why it matters: Easy to buy, easy to forget, easy to lose oversight of.


SaaS Sprawl

The slow accumulation of overlapping software subscriptions across a business.

Why it matters: Drives up cost, complexity, and data exposure.


Shadow AI

AI tools used by staff without formal approval or visibility.

Why it matters: Free and embedded AI has made this widespread.


Shadow IT

Technology used in the business without IT’s knowledge, usually to get work done faster.

Why it matters: AI has accelerated this significantly.


Stack

The collection of software tools a business relies on to operate.

Why it matters: Every business has a stack — planned or not.


Vibe Coding

Using AI to generate code based on natural language, without fully understanding how it works.

Why it matters: Fast to build, hard to maintain.


Zero-Click AI

AI systems that take action automatically without user interaction.

Why it matters: Fewer clicks mean fewer chances to stop mistakes.
